Do you already own a small business or want to start one and/or a 501 (c)3 nonprofit organization and need to learn how to write grants to get funded? A grant is money that does not have to be repaid back. Did you know that LLCs (For-profit entities) can be eligible to apply for certain grant funding particularly from government agencies and private foundations that offer grants specifically designed for small businesses? If awarded a grant the money doesn’t have to be repaid back.
